The show focuses on the rich history and evolution of blues music, with episodes covering the lives and contributions of influential artists like Junior Wells and Muddy Waters, alongside personal anecdotes from Kevin Purcell's experiences in 'Music Land' and the local music scene.

The Bus Stop Blues podcast, a three times a week radio show broadcasted from live and recorded at 98.3 FM
– The Life radio station in Northern Lake County, Illinois from 7pm on Tuesday’s, Thursday’s and Sunday nights.
The show features blues inspired music, with originals from Kevin Purcell & The Nightburners as well as
Blues legends from today and yesteryear. The show includes “Tales From The Road” a recurring feature, plus witty
conversations from your hosts and special in studio guests.

EPISODE #70
3/08/26 -REVELATOR, A Tribute to Tedeschi Trucks Band
Hosts: Kevin Purcell & Road Bill
This week on The Bus Stop Blues, Road Bill and Kevin “Papa Blues” Purcell welcome a band that brings the soul, power, and spirit of one of modern blues’ most beloved groups to life. Our guests are Revelator, a powerhouse tribute to the music of the Tedeschi Trucks Band.
Blending blues, Southern soul, gospel energy, and soaring guitar work, Revelator captures the heart and groove that have made Susan Tedeschi and Derek Trucks a cornerstone of modern roots music. In this episode, we talk music, influences, and the passion behind honoring one of the most dynamic bands on the road today.
